Movie Info

Synopsis A scandalized French champagne tycoon (Maurice Ronet) suspects his U.S. partner's (Yvonne Furneaux) gigolo husband (Anthony Perkins).
Director
Claude Chabrol
Producer
Raymond Eger
Production Co
Universal Pictures
Genre
Crime, Drama
Original Language
English
Runtime
1h 38m
